Biochem/physiol Actions
Dirithromycin is a macrolide antibiotic. It is a prodrug of erythromycylamine that has outstanding activity against Campylobacter. Dirithromycin is a group 3 agent with respect to its interaction with cytochrome P450 (CYP) isoform 3A4, as it interferes poorly with CYP3A4 in vitro and generally does not alter drug metabolism in vivo.

Preparation Note
When dissolving dirithromycin in organic solvents, first purge the solvent with inert gas.
To prepare in aqueous buffer, dirithromycin should first be dissolved in ethanol and then diluted with aqueous buffer. The solution is stable for one day.
Dirithromycin is soluble in ethanol at approximately 20 mg/mL, DMF at approximately 10 mg/mL, and DMSO at approximately 15 mg/mL.
